Southport journalist Martin Hovden writes: The shock revelation today that Labour lied about an event where leader Sir Keir Starmer is alleged to have broken lockdown rules will send shockwaves among candidates standing in next week's council elections.
The Tories were already braced for losses because of Boris Johnson's fine for attending a Downing Street party at the height of Covid restrictions.
Now Labour has been thrown into disarray after the Daily Mail revealed deputy leader Angela Rayner was present at the Keir Starmer event in April last year, after denying her presence for months.
“Previous denials were an honest mistake,” a Labour source told the newspaper.
Understandably, the public are now likely to conclude “they were all at it”.
The Partygate scandal is - in theory - a gift for the Liberal Democrats in Southport, now their Tory and Labour opponents are on the ropes.
Next Thursday's Sefton Council election will be an opportunity for voters to decide if they want to punish political parties involved in the Covid row.
Polling stations are open from 7am to 10pm on Thursday, May 5.
